.auth-wrapper-modern[data-v-7b0315de]{min-height:100vh;width:100%;position:relative;overflow:hidden}.auth-row[data-v-7b0315de]{height:100vh}.auth-image-section[data-v-7b0315de]{position:relative;overflow:hidden}.auth-image-section .auth-bg-image[data-v-7b0315de]{position:absolute;width:100%;height:100%;top:0;left:0;z-index:0}.auth-image-section .image-overlay[data-v-7b0315de]{position:absolute;width:100%;height:100%;top:0;left:0;z-index:1;background:linear-gradient(135deg,rgba(103,58,183,.9),rgba(63,81,181,.85) 50%,rgba(33,150,243,.8));display:flex;align-items:center;justify-content:center;padding:3rem}.auth-image-section .overlay-content[data-v-7b0315de]{max-width:700px;text-align:center;animation:fadeInUp-7b0315de 1s ease-out}.auth-form-section[data-v-7b0315de]{display:flex;align-items:center;justify-content:center;padding:2rem;background:#fff}.auth-form-section .auth-form-wrapper[data-v-7b0315de]{width:100%;max-width:450px;padding:2rem;animation:fadeIn-7b0315de .8s ease-out}.auth-form-section .form-header h2[data-v-7b0315de]{color:#2c3e50}@keyframes fadeInUp-7b0315de{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eIn-7b0315de{0%{opacity:0}to{opacity:1}}@media(max-width:959px){.auth-form-section[data-v-7b0315de]{padding:1.5rem}.auth-form-section .auth-form-wrapper[data-v-7b0315de]{padding:1rem}}[data-v-7b0315de] .v-text-field--outlined fieldset{border-color:rgba(0,0,0,.12);transition:border-color .3s ease}[data-v-7b0315de] .v-text-field--outlined:hover fieldset{border-color:rgba(0,0,0,.25)}[data-v-7b0315de] .v-text-field--outlined.v-input--is-focused fieldset{border-width:2px}[data-v-7b0315de] .v-btn{transition:all .3s ease}[data-v-7b0315de] .v-btn:hover{transform:translateY(-2px);box-shadow:0 8px 16px rgba(0,0,0,.2)!important}a[data-v-7b0315de]{transition:color .3s ease}a[data-v-7b0315de]:hover{text-decoration:underline!important}